Darya Khan’s Tomb
Darya Khan’s Tomb is a monument in Pithampur, Dhar, Madhya Pradesh. Darya Khan’s Tomb is situated nearby to Darya Khan’s Mosque, as well as near the ruins Lal Sarai.Places in the Area

Mandu or Mandav literally meaning the City of Joy is a small town in the state of Madhya Pradesh in India, now best known for a fort built by Baaz Bahadur in the memory of his queen Rani Roopmati.
